Hacker arrest Update & Clarification:

Police stepped back from definitively identifying Cesar Alexis Atoche as “Cyber Alexis,” saying in a written statement released Friday to the Andean Air Mail & Peruvian Times that Atoche “could be the person who ‘hacked’ into the Chilean Housing Ministry and Interior Ministry pages in 2005 and 2007.”

Police spokesman Lt. Col. Manuel Diaz said Atoche was being interrogated in the presence of a defense lawyer, and that police were not ready to identify him as Cyber Alexis.

“There is evidence, but there isn’t proof,” he said, adding that the investigation was ongoing.
